大鼠三叉神经脊束间质核内接受内脏伤害性信息的含CB神经元向孤束核的投射  被引量:2

PROJECTION OF THE CALBINDIN D-28K NEURONS RECEIVING VISCERAL NOCICEPTIVE INFORMATION FROM INTERSTITIAL NUCLEUS OF THE SPINAL TRIGEMINAL TRACT TO NUCLEUS OF THE SOLITARY TRACT IN THE RAT

摘  要:目的 探讨大鼠三叉神经脊束间质核 (INV)内接受内脏伤害性信息的含calbindinD 2 8K(CB)神经元与孤束核 (NTS)的投射联系。 方法 用福尔马林刺激上消化道 ,应用荧光金 (FG)逆行束路追踪结合Fos和CB的免疫荧光组织化学三重标记法。 结果 INV的背侧边缘旁核 (PaMd)和三叉旁核 (PaV)内可见到大量FG逆标细胞 ,以注射FG的同侧为主。大部分FG逆标细胞 (约 71 2 %)为CB免疫反应阳性。部分FG和CB双标记神经元(约 31 5 %)同时呈Fos免疫反应阳性的三重标记。 结论 INV内部分接受内脏伤害性刺激的CB神经元可直接投射至NTS ,含CB的神经元在内脏伤害性信息经INV向NTS的传导通路中 。Objective To investigate the calbindin D\|28K (CB) neurons that receive the visceral nociceptive information in the interstitial nucleus of the spinal trigeminal tract (INV) directly project to the nucleus of the solitary tract (NTS). Methods Triple\|labeled methods of fluorogold (FG) retrograde tracing combined with Fos and CB proteins immunofluorescence histochemistry after formalin stimulating upper alimentary tract. Results Most of FG\|retrograde labeled neurons distributed in the paratrigeminal nucleus (PaV) and the dorsal paramarginal nucleus (PaMd) of INV ipsilateral to the FG injection. About 71\^2% of FG\|retrograde labeled neurons contained CB and 31\^5% of FG/CB double\|labeled neurons exhibited positive Fos\|immunoreaction in INV.Conclusion The results suggested that a part of neurons containing CB in INV receive the visceral nociceptive information and directly project to NTS. CB neurons might play an important role in transmitting visceral nociceptive information from INV to NTS. [
